Mantsebo
Mantsebo is a locality in Lesotho and has about 9,220 residents and an elevation of 1,661 metres. Mantsebo is situated nearby to the locality Upper Qeme, as well as near the village Lower Qeme.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mazenod
Suburb
Mazenod is a community council located in the Maseru District of western Lesotho. The population in 2006 was 27,553. It is located to the south-east of the capital Maseru. Mazenod is situated 9 km northeast of Mantsebo.
